Message type: E = Error
Message class: EMX - IS-U Parking
Message number: 003
Message text: Data for installation &1 (&2) contains errors

- Data for installation &1 (&2) contains errors ?The SAP error message EMX003 indicates that there are errors in the data for a specific installation (identified by &1) and a specific component or object (identified by &2). This error typically arises during the installation or configuration of a software component or when trying to execute a transaction that involves installation data.
Causes:
- Data Integrity Issues: The installation data may contain invalid or inconsistent entries, such as incorrect data types, missing mandatory fields, or references to non-existent objects.
- Configuration Errors: There may be misconfigurations in the system settings or parameters that are required for the installation.
- Version Mismatch: The version of the software component being installed may not be compatible with the existing system or other components.
- Authorization Issues: The user executing the installation may not have the necessary authorizations to access or modify the installation data.
- Transport Issues: If the installation data was transported from another system, there may have been issues during the transport process that led to data corruption.
Solutions:
- Check Data Entries: Review the installation data for the specified installation and component. Look for any inconsistencies or errors in the data entries.
- Validate Configuration: Ensure that all necessary configurations are correctly set up. This may involve checking system parameters, dependencies, and prerequisites for the installation.
- Compatibility Check: Verify that the version of the software component is compatible with your current SAP system version and other installed components.
- User Authorizations: Ensure that the user executing the installation has the appropriate authorizations. You may need to consult with your SAP security team to verify and adjust user roles.
- Transport Logs: If the data was transported, check the transport logs for any errors or warnings that may indicate issues during the transport process. You may need to re-transport the data or correct any identified issues.
- S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address this specific error message. SAP frequently releases notes that provide solutions or workarounds for known issues.
